nkag siab txog lithium aluminium hydride: lub zog txo tus neeg sawv cev

Chemical Properties thiab Structure

Cov khoom yog ib qho inorganic compound uas muaj lithium, txhuas, thiab hydrogen atoms. Nws yog dawb crystalline khoom uas yog reactive heev vim nws muaj zog txo zog. Hauv LiAlH4, txhuas yog nyob rau hauv +3 oxidation xeev thiab ua raws li qhov chaw ntawm hydride ions (H^-), uas yog ib qho tseem ceeb rau nws txo cov peev xwm.

 

Cov hydride ions no tuaj yeem pub cov khoom siv hluav taws xob zoo, ua rau LiAlH4 muaj peev xwm txo qis ntau pawg ua haujlwm hauv cov tshuaj lom neeg, xws li carbonyl compounds (aldehydes, ketones, carboxylic acids, esters) rau lawv cov cawv sib xws.

Cov tshuaj tiv thaiv ntawm lithium aluminium hydride thiab aldehydes

Tam sim no, cia peb hais cov lus nug kub: Puas yog cov khoom txo qis aldehydes? Cov lus teb yog ib qho resounding yog! Qhov tseeb, LAH muaj txiaj ntsig tshwj xeeb ntawm kev txo cov aldehydes rau thawj cov cawv.

Thaum ib qho aldehyde reacts nrog cov khoom, cov carbonyl pawg (C=O) ntawm aldehyde hloov mus rau hydroxyl pawg (OH). Qhov kev hloov pauv no tshwm sim los ntawm ntau cov kauj ruam:

Lub hydride ion (H-) los ntawm LAH tawm tsam cov carbonyl carbon ntawm aldehyde.

Qhov no tsim ib qho alkoxide nruab nrab.

Thaum ua haujlwm (feem ntau yog dej los yog cov kua qaub tsis muaj zog), alkoxide yog protonated los tsim cov cawv thawj.

Cov tshuaj tiv thaiv zuag qhia tag nrho tuaj yeem ua tiav raws li:

RCHO + LiAlH4→ RCH2OH

Cov tshuaj tiv thaiv no feem ntau nrawm thiab tshwm sim nyob rau hauv cov mob me, feem ntau ntawm chav tsev kub lossis nrog cua sov. Cov txiaj ntsig ntawm cov tshuaj tiv thaiv no feem ntau yog siab heev, ua rau LAH nyiam xaiv los txo cov aldehydes hauv ntau txoj kev hluavtaws.

Nws tsim nyog sau cia tias cov khoom tsis nres ntawm aldehydes. Nws muaj peev xwm txo tau ntau yam ntawm lwm pab pawg ua haujlwm, suav nrog ketones, carboxylic acids, esters, thiab txawm tias qee pawg tsis tshua muaj zog xws li amides thiab nitriles. Qhov kev rov ua kom dav dav no yog ob qho tib si lub zog thiab muaj peev xwm sib tw thaum siv LAH hauv cov molecules nyuaj nrog ntau pawg txo qis.

 

Cov tswv yim xav txog thaum siv lithium aluminium hydride

ThaumLithium Aluminium Hydrideyog undoubtedly ib tug haib cuab tam nyob rau hauv cov organic synthesis, nws yog ib qho tseem ceeb kom nkag siab txog nws cov tswv yim thiab cov kev txwv:

Reactivity

LAH yog qhov muaj zog heev, uas txhais tau hais tias nws tuaj yeem txo ntau pawg ua haujlwm. Txawm hais tias qhov no feem ntau muaj txiaj ntsig zoo, nws tuaj yeem ua rau tsis muaj kev xav sab nraud hauv cov molecules nyuaj. Cov kws kho mob yuav tsum ua tib zoo xav txog qhov muaj lwm pab pawg txo qis thaum npaj siv LAH.

rhiab heev

LAH yog rhiab heev rau ya raws thiab huab cua. Nws reacts hnyav nrog dej, ua hydrogen gas. Yog li ntawd, nws yuav tsum tau ua nyob rau hauv qhuav, inert tej yam kev mob, feem ntau siv anhydrous solvents thiab nyob rau hauv ib tug nitrogen los yog argon cua.

Kev nyab xeeb

Vim nws qhov reactivity, LAH ua rau muaj kev nyab xeeb tseem ceeb. Nws yog pyrophoric (tuaj yeem ignite spontaneously hauv huab cua) thiab tuaj yeem ua rau hluav taws kub yog tias tsis ua haujlwm zoo. Kev cob qhia kom raug thiab cov cuab yeej siv kev nyab xeeb yog qhov tseem ceeb thaum ua haujlwm nrog cov khoom siv no.

Solvent xaiv

LAH feem ntau yog siv rau hauv cov kuab tshuaj ethereal xws li diethyl ether lossis tetrahydrofuran (THF). Cov kuab tshuaj no tuaj yeem koom tes nrog cov txhuas, txhim kho qhov txo qis zog ntawm LAH.

Ua haujlwm

Kev ua haujlwm ntawm LAH cov tshuaj tiv thaiv yuav tsum tau saib xyuas. Tshaj LAH yuav tsum tau quenched maj mam thiab ua tib zoo, feem ntau nrog dej, ethyl acetate, los yog sodium sulfate, kom tsis txhob muaj kev kub ntxhov.
